Pyrogasification It is a technology that allows the transformation of organic and carbon based material into a clean syngas that can compete with fossil fuels.

It consists of two phases:

•The pyrolysis which thermally (between 450 ᵒC and 1000 ᵒC) treats the material without oxygen in order to produce syngas, biofuel and char.

•The gasification which transforms the char and biofuel into syngas through adding small quantities of oxygen.

InputsoPlastic (Polyethylene, Polystyrene, PVC…)oTiresoHospital wasteoSludge from purifying plants, urban and industrialoWoodoAgriculture ResiduesoOrganic wasteoOil Based wasteoChemical waste

Other types of waste can be treated but might require special pre-treatment or post-treatment.

The waste entering should preferably be sorted in order to increase the efficiency of the machine.

OutputsoCombustible Syngas

oChar

oBiofuel

oMineral residues

The percentage of Biofuel and Syngas may vary depending on the speed and temperature of the process. The higher the temperature and speed the more syngas is produced.

Advantageso Clean technology due to better control of pollutants in the absence of oxygen which creates harmful gases such as Nox

oSpeed and uniformity of heat transfer makes the machine superior to others while giving stable outcome

oMore energy efficient than incineration

oNo landfilling required

oAllows to produce clean renewable gas which is competitive with natural gas

oMachines are easily transported and do not require a lot of space
